AfterGen, потому что переопределяете цвет не на том элементе. Это как, есть, например, header и footer, вы меняете цвет у header, но хотите чтобы он поменялся у footer.
saplas, вполне себе нормальное решение, зачем использовать в блоке то, что там не нужно? Сетка нужна для определённых решений. Здесь она только мешает. Не понимаю какие у тебя проблемы с тем, чтобы её в этом блоке не использовать. Делаешь блок - задаёшь ему background-image, внутри делаешь блок с текстом и кнопкой, ставишь отступы как надо, позиционируешь, если у тебя это две разные картинки (фон и сертификаты), то внутри родительского блока можно создать ещё элемент и позиционировать его.
saplas, так речь и идёт об этом блоке в вопросе, а не о всем макете. Я не предлагаю отказываться от сетки совсем, но в данном случае она не уместна. Хочешь костылять - вперёд. Выводы как получилось сделать - опыт работы.
saplas, ответь на вопрос, для чего нужна сетка бутстрапа и для чего ее целесообразно использовать? для каких целей в данном блоке ты хочешь ее использовать?
Почитай для чего используется свойство content, как спойлер - тебе туда нужно написать кавычки
Делаешь псевдоэлемент абсолютно спозиционированным, навешиваешь какие нужно стили для выравнивания и внешного вида твоего блока, не забудь родителю указать relative
Антон Р., если смотреть со стороны семантики, то именно text-decoration предназначен для подчеркивания, к тому же ему так же можно задать цвет, пунктир и тд. Бордером конечно тоже можно, но стоит ли?
xonar, Медиазапросы нужно использовать только в том случае, если по другому никак не сделать. То есть да, для какого-то разрешения экрана нужны другие стили. Если какие-то свойства можно сразу задать - то так и нужно делать, но не дублировать их в медиа
xonar, Ну flex-wrap просто задает перенос блоков как и white-space, например, для пробелов между словами. Это просто свойство, которое автоматом подстраивается под ширину экрана. В этом случае конечно нет смысла использовать медиазпросы.
maksipes, ну тут можно долго спорить. Можно почитать спецификацию, там есть примеры, и там grid используется, не только для макета страницы. Получается что grid стоит использовать там, где блоки нужно расположить по сетке какой-либо.